I also had a stage 2b tumour removed, along with full hysterectomy, at the end of 2020. Just completed 6 cycles of chemo on Carboplatin and Paclitaxel, and keeping everything crossed for confirmation that I’m now in remission and moving on to 3-monthly checkups.
For me the side effects weren’t too bad overall. The anti-sickness meds did a great job of keeping nausea and sickness away (and ginger biscuits and ginger tea did the rest!). Constipation was a challenge until I discovered Dulco-ease and became best friends with prune juice , and my red and white blood counts have been a bit up and down over the weeks, so I’ve been strict about not eating processed meats, raw and undercooked eggs and fish, unpasteurised dairy and washing all my fruit and salad, to avoid infection.
All I’m left with now is neuropathy in my toes (which I’m told might take a few months to get better). One to watch out for - and now taking Vitamin B6 and massaging with lavender and chamomile as recommended to me.....will let you know if it works !

Does this chemo cause complete hair loss for sure? I am in half a mind to do something bonkers this time like dye what short hair I have bright green or something but dont want to look totally daft 3 months later!!

I used a cold cap during my treatments so managed to keep most of my hair - Everybody else I’ve spoken to though who has been on Paclitaxel without using the cold cap has lost all or most of their hair by cycle 2 or 3. So, if bright green hair will make you smile right now then I’d say go for it
